14. well, that sounds pretty good
...but what kind of relish? If it's sweet relish, hmmmm.

Mine: potatoes cooked to a T (not mushy), Best Food (Hellman's) mayo, hard-boiled eggs, diced dill pickles, dill weed, pepper, diced celery, diced sweet onion, a bit of celery seed, sliced olives, a short dab of mustard, a scant teaspoon sugar, and salt to taste. It's after my grandmother's New England style.

19. traditionally...
...the reuben was made with a russian dressing before people's lives became so complicated.

1 c. salad oil
3/4 c. chili sauce
1 c. sugar
1/2 c. tarragon vinegar
1 lg. onion, grated
1 tsp. salt
1 tsp. paprika
1 tsp. lemon juice
